Данный перевод возможен двумя способами: прямой перевод и через десятичную систему.
Сначала выполним перевод через десятичную систему
Выполним перевод в десятичную систему счисления вот так:
4∙161+0∙160+5∙16-1+14∙16-2+11∙16-3+8∙16-4+5∙16-5+1∙16-6+14∙16-7+11∙16-8+8∙16-9+5∙16-10 = 4∙16+0∙1+5∙0.0625+14∙0.00390625+11∙0.000244140625+8∙1.52587890625E-5+5∙9.5367431640625E-7+1∙5.9604644775391E-8+14∙3.7252902984619E-9+11∙2.3283064365387E-10+8∙1.4551915228367E-11+5∙9.0949470177293E-13 = 64+0+0.3125+0.0546875+0.002685546875+0.0001220703125+4.7683715820312E-6+5.9604644775391E-8+5.2154064178467E-8+2.5611370801926E-9+1.1641532182693E-10+4.5474735088646E-12 = 64.3699999999998910
Получилось: 40.5EB851EB8516 =64.3699999999998910
Переведем число 64.3699999999998910 в восьмеричное вот так:
Целая часть числа находится делением на основание новой системы счисления:
| 64 | 8 | | |
| -64 | 8 | 8 | |
| 0 | -8 | 1 | |
| 0 | | |
 |
Дробная часть числа находится умножением на основание новой системы счисления:
 |
| 0. | 36999999999989*8 |
| 2 | .96*8 |
| 7 | .68*8 |
| 5 | .44*8 |
| 3 | .52*8 |
| 4 | .16*8 |
| 1 | .28*8 |
| 2 | .24*8 |
| 1 | .92*8 |
| 7 | .35999*8 |
| 2 | .87988*8 |
В результате преобразования получилось:
64.3699999999998910 = 100.27534121728
Окончательный ответ: 40.5EB851EB8516 = 100.27534121728
Теперь выполним прямой перевод.
Выполним прямой перевод из шестнадцатиричной в двоичную вот так:
40.5EB851EB8516 = 4 0. 5 E B 8 5 1 E B 8 5 = 4(=0100) 0(=0000). 5(=0101) E(=1110) B(=1011) 8(=1000) 5(=0101) 1(=0001) E(=1110) B(=1011) 8(=1000) 5(=0101) = 1000000.01011110101110000101000111101011100001012
Окончательный ответ: 40.5EB851EB8516 = 1000000.01011110101110000101000111101011100001012
Дополним число недостающими нулями слева
Дополним число недостающими нулями справа
Выполним прямой перевод из двоичной в восмиричную вот так:
001000000.0101111010111000010100011110101110000101002 = 001 000 000. 010 111 101 011 100 001 010 001 111 010 111 000 010 100 = 001(=1) 000(=0) 000(=0). 010(=2) 111(=7) 101(=5) 011(=3) 100(=4) 001(=1) 010(=2) 001(=1) 111(=7) 010(=2) 111(=7) 000(=0) 010(=2) 100(=4) = 100.275341217270248
Окончательный ответ: 40.5EB851EB8516 = 100.275341217270248